We have other current jobs related to this field that you can find below


  • Wilmington, Delaware, United States Michael Page US Full time

    Responibilities for the Principal Software Engineer include but are not limited to:Design, develop, and test instrument system software to co-exist and integrate seamlessly with distributed firmware and hardware elements following API-first principles. Model lead developer behavior through building system-level product perspective, establishing and following...


  • Wilmington, North Carolina, United States TAP Engineering Full time

    Job OverviewJob ID: TAP00050Position: Lead Software EngineerLocation: United StatesCategory: Software DevelopmentClearance Requirement: Active TS/SCI with full scope polygraphEducation Requirement: None specifiedExperience Requirement: Minimum of 8 yearsTAP Engineering is seeking a dedicated Lead Software Engineer who thrives in a fast-paced and innovative...


  • Wilmington, North Carolina, United States Ring0 Full time

    Position: Lead Software EngineerLocation: Hanover, MDCompensation: $120,000 - $160,000 annuallyCompany Overview: Ring0 Technologies is seeking a dedicated Software Engineer who is eager to enhance their programming expertise in the field of cybersecurity. This role involves joining an innovative cybersecurity team and tackling complex challenges in advanced...


  • Wilmington, North Carolina, United States General Dynamics Information Technology Full time

    Req ID: RQ182351Type of Requisition: RegularClearance Level Must Be Able to Obtain: Top Secret SCI + PolygraphPublic Trust/Other Required: NoneJob Family: Software EngineeringSkills:Application Development, C#.NET, Full Stack Development, Collaborative Problem Solving, Software DevelopmentExperience:2 + years of relevant experienceUS Citizenship...

  • .Net / C# Developer

    1 month ago


    Wilmington, United States Crescens Full time

    Job title : .Net / C# Developer Location: Raleigh, NC Duration : 10+ months Type : Contract ***The candidate will be allowed to work remotely until all staff return to site. At that point the candidate will be required to come onsite.*** ***Only candidates currently living in the Raleigh, NC area will be considered for this position. *** Short Description:...


  • Wilmington, North Carolina, United States Lockheed Martin Full time

    Senior Software Development Engineer at Lockheed MartinLockheed Martin, specializing in Cybersecurity and Intelligence, is seeking an experienced Senior Software Development Engineer to become a vital part of our team. If you are enthusiastic about safeguarding digital environments and working with innovative technologies, this role may be ideal for you.In...


  • Wilmington, North Carolina, United States ManTech Full time

    Secure Our Nation, Ignite Your FutureBecome an integral part of a diverse team while working at a leading organization in the industry, where employees come first. At ManTech International Corporation, you'll help protect national security while working on innovative projects that offer opportunities for advancement.Currently, ManTech is seeking a motivated,...


  • Wilmington, United States Metric Geo Full time

    Metric GEO is working with a 100% employee owned, equal opportunity and diverse company, with a great reputation and deep history, over 100 years of experience in the complex engineering projects. Recognized by Glassdoor as a 2023 Top 100 place to work, they prioritise work culture and collaboration just as much as they do hard work and precision. They are...


  • Wilmington, North Carolina, United States ManTech Full time

    Secure our Nation, Ignite your FutureBecome an integral part of a diverse team while working at an Industry Leading Organization, where our employees come first. At ManTech International Corporation, you'll help protect our national security while working on innovative projects that offer opportunities for advancement.Currently, ManTech is seeking a...


  • Wilmington, United States International Flavors & Fragrances Full time

    Lead Engineer, Microbial Physiology and Fermentation Its an exciting time to be part of the IFF family. The combination of IFF and DuPont Nutrition & Biosciences unites us to form a global leader in taste, scent, nutrition and biosciences, offering Engineer, Leadership, Bioscience, Product Development, Group Leader, Project Lead, Manufacturing, Business...


  • Wilmington, Massachusetts, United States Wunderlich-Malec Full time

    Company Overview:Wunderlich-Malec Engineering (WM) is a fully employee-owned ESOP and stands as one of the most prominent and established engineering firms in the United States. Joining WM means becoming part of a company that is:Completely employee-owned with over four decades of industry experience.A recognized leader among the Top 5 Systems...


  • Wilmington, Massachusetts, United States Cessna Aircraft Company Full time

    Job Description - Systems Engineering LeadJob Number: 319978Company OverviewCessna Aircraft Company is a leader in the aviation industry, renowned for its commitment to innovation and excellence. Our team of skilled professionals is dedicated to designing and manufacturing aircraft that meet the highest standards of quality and performance.Role OverviewWe...


  • Wilmington, Massachusetts, United States Cessna Aircraft Company Full time

    Job Description - Systems Engineering LeadJob Number: 319978Company OverviewCessna Aircraft Company is a prominent entity within the aviation industry, recognized for its commitment to innovation and excellence. We specialize in the design and manufacturing of advanced aircraft, delivering solutions that enhance air travel and transportation.Role OverviewWe...


  • Wilmington, Delaware, United States KLM Careers Full time

    Job OverviewThe role of Senior Controls Engineer is critical within our organization. This position is designed for an experienced professional who possesses a strong technical background in automation solutions.Location: Wilmington, MAEligibility: Must be a US Citizen or Green Card holder.This position entails leading a team of engineers to identify...


  • Wilmington, United States KBR, Inc. Full time

    Under broad direction, you will supervise and lead a group of engineers and designers while assigned to the home office in Newark, DE. You will provide technical direction over a group (2-15 depending on project), coaching and professional development of lower-level engineering and design professionals. You will also be responsible for the planning,...


  • Wilmington, United States KBR Full time

    Under broad direction, you will supervise and lead a group of engineers and designers while assigned to the home office in Newark, DE. You will provide technical direction over a group (2-15 depending on project), coaching and professional development of lower-level engineering and design professionals. You will also be responsible for the planning,...


  • Wilmington, United States KBR, Inc. Full time

    Under broad direction, you will supervise and lead a group of engineers and designers while assigned to the home office in Newark, DE. You will provide technical direction over a group (2-15 depending on project), coaching and professional development of lower-level engineering and design professionals. You will also be responsible for the planning,...


  • Wilmington, Massachusetts, United States Cessna Aircraft Company Full time

    Job Description - Systems Engineering LeadJob Number: 319978Company OverviewCessna Aircraft Company is a leader in the aviation industry, renowned for its innovative aircraft designs and commitment to excellence. We are dedicated to delivering high-quality products that meet the diverse needs of our customers in the aerospace sector.Position OverviewWe are...


  • Wilmington, Massachusetts, United States L3 Technologies Full time

    Job Title: Quality Technician C Job Code: 14967 Job Location: Wilmington, MA Position Overview: The Quality Technician C is responsible for executing inspections, evaluations, and audits of procured components, materials, and assemblies to ensure compliance with established specifications. This role involves interpreting technical drawings, schematics, and...


  • Wilmington, Massachusetts, United States L3 Technologies Full time

    Job Title: Quality Technician C Job Code: 14967 Job Location: Wilmington, MA Job Overview: The Quality Technician C is accountable for executing inspections, evaluations, and audits of procured components, materials, equipment, and assemblies in accordance with established specifications. This role involves interpreting technical drawings, diagrams, and...

Lead C++ Engineer

2 months ago


Wilmington, United States BigRio Full time

Job Title: Lead C++ Engineer

Wilmington, MA

Complete Onsite


About BigR.io :

BigR.io is a remote-based, technology consulting firm headquartered in Boston, MA. We deliver software solutions ranging from custom development, software implementation, data analytics, and machine learning/AI integrations. We are a one-stop shop that attracts clients from a variety of industries because of our proven ability to deliver cutting-edge and cost-conscious software solutions.

Our thought-forward, Big Data team is working on a number of data architecture and software-solution projects. You will join this high-caliber team as a Technical Consultant who will work with our clients to implement software-based solutions to fit their needs.



Job Summary:

We are seeking a skilled and experienced Lead C++ Engineer with expertise in Real-Time Operating Systems (RTOS) and Programmable Logic Controllers (PLC) to join our manufacturing industry team. As a Lead C++ Engineer, you will be responsible for designing, developing, and maintaining software solutions that integrate with RTOS and PLC systems. You will also be there to help and guide less experienced engineers to understand best practices. Your work will contribute to the efficiency, safety, and overall performance of our manufacturing processes.


Key Responsibilities:

  • Designing and developing software solutions using C++ programming language.
  • Collaborating with cross-functional teams, including hardware engineers and control system specialists, to understand system requirements and develop appropriate software solutions.
  • Creating C++ software applications in a Real-Time Operating System to ensure efficient and deterministic performance.
  • Implementing communication protocols and interfaces to connect software applications with Programmable Logic Controllers (PLCs) and other control devices.
  • Writing efficient, reliable, and maintainable code that meets quality and performance standards.
  • Conducting unit testing and debugging of software components to identify and resolve any defects or issues.
  • Participating in code reviews to ensure adherence to coding standards and best practices.
  • Documenting software design, implementation, and maintenance activities.
  • Keeping up-to-date with industry trends, emerging technologies, and best practices related to RTOS, PLC, and manufacturing software development.


Qualifications:

  • Bachelor's degree in Computer Science, Software Engineering, or a related field. Relevant work experience may be considered in lieu of a degree.
  • Excellent communication skills with the ability to act as a mentor to less experienced engineers.
  • Proven Sr. level of experience in software development using C++.
  • Strong knowledge of Real-Time Operating Systems (RTOS), including principles and best practices for real-time software development.
  • Experience in integrating software applications with Programmable Logic Controllers (PLCs) and other control devices.
  • Familiarity with communication protocols and interfaces commonly used in industrial automation, such as Modbus, Profibus, or Ethernet/IP.
  • Solid understanding of software development processes and methodologies.
  • Proficiency in debugging and troubleshooting complex software systems.
  • Strong problem-solving and analytical skills..
  • Experience in the manufacturing industry or related industry.


Preferred Qualifications:

Experience with additional programming languages such C#.

Knowledge of GUI would be an advantage

Knowledge of agile software development methodologies.

Understanding of software testing practices and familiarity with automated testing frameworks.



BigRio is not open to working with outside Recruiting shops at this time.



Equal Opportunity Statement

BigRio is an equal-opportunity employer. We prohibit discrimination and harassment of any kind based on race, religion, national origin, sex, sexual orientation, gender identity, age, pregnancy, status as a qualified individual with disability, protected veteran status, or other protected characteristic as outlined by federal, state, or local laws. BigRio makes hiring decisions based solely on qualifications, merit, and business needs at the time. All qualified applicants will receive equal consideration for employment.